Chrissy Teigen joins husband John Legend and baby Luna for some Christmas shopping... following Twitter smackdown of Donald Trump

On Friday she let Trump have a piece of her mind about his inaugural booking complaints.

But on Friday Chrissy Teigen seemed to simply want to move on, as she stepped out with husband John Legend and eight-month-old daughter Luna for some pre-Christmas shopping in Beverly Hills.

The 31-year-old stunner looked as chic as ever for the family outing.

Chrissy seemed to be in a downright cheerful mood, which was definitely in contrast to her mood from the night before, when she took to Twitter to call out Donald Trump for complaining about the lack of talent scheduled for his upcoming inauguration.

The president-elect said: 'The so-called 'A' list celebrities are all wanting tixs to the inauguration, but look what they did for Hillary, NOTHING,' stated the University of Pennsylvania graduate 'I want the PEOPLE!'

In response to Trump's tweet, Chrissy responded 'hi - we are people,' presumably responding to his request for human audience members.

'You are our president too. I don't want you to be, but u are,' she continued, before throwing a little shade in Trump's direction with, 'also we ALL know you are dying without the approval, dear.'
